#89322E Hex color

#89322E

The hexadecimal color code #89322E corresponds to the code RGB( 137, 50, 46 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,54 level), green (at 0,20 level) and blue (at 0,18 level). Its brightness is 35% and its saturation is 49%. It is composed of red at 58%, green at 21% and blue at 19%.
